kuldalai Posted September 4, 2012 #2 Share Posted September 4, 2012 In the case of both Livorno to Firenze SMN and Civitavecchia to Roma Termini the majority of services are local trains with no seat reservations. So just bowl up at both Livorno and Civitavecchia stations and buy your tickets. Be sure to validate your ticket at the platform entry in the yellow validation machines before undertaking each train trip. Failure to validate incurs a hefty on the spot fine. euro cruiser Posted September 4, 2012 #4 Share Posted September 4, 2012 In Civitavecchia the ticket you want is called a BIRG; it is a regional transportation ticket that covers both the train and public transit in Rome. This ticket is not available online, it can only be purchased in person. You can buy one at newsstands in Civitavecchia or at the train station (I found the newsstand in the train station to be the fastest purchase, no line).
